#include "lib/self_test.h"

#include "graphics/Color.h"
#include "ps/CLogger.h"

#include <cstring>

class TestColor : public CxxTest::TestSuite
{
public:
	void setUp()
	{
		ColorActivateFastImpl();
	}

	void test_Color4ub()
	{
		CheckColor(0, 0, 0, 0x000000);
		CheckColor(1, 0, 0, 0x0000ff);
		CheckColor(0, 1, 0, 0x00ff00);
		CheckColor(0, 0, 1, 0xff0000);
		CheckColor(1, 1, 1, 0xffffff);
	}

	void test_parse()
	{
		TestLogger nolog;
#define CHECK_CCOLOR_EQUAL(v,r,g,b,a) \
	{ \
		CStr str = v; \
		CColor c; \
		TS_ASSERT(c.ParseString(str, 255)); \
		CColor c_(r/255.f,g/255.f,b/255.f,a/255.f); \
		TS_ASSERT_EQUALS(c, c_); \
	}

		CHECK_CCOLOR_EQUAL("0 0 0 0", 0, 0, 0, 0);
		CHECK_CCOLOR_EQUAL("255 0 255 0", 255, 0, 255, 0);
		CHECK_CCOLOR_EQUAL("0 123 0 0", 0, 123, 0, 0);
		CHECK_CCOLOR_EQUAL("0 0 0 55", 0, 0, 0, 55);
		CHECK_CCOLOR_EQUAL("76 24 0", 76, 24, 0, 255);
		CHECK_CCOLOR_EQUAL("159 98 24", 159, 98, 24, 255);
#undef CHECK_CCOLOR_EQUAL
	}

	void test_parse_failure()
	{
		TestLogger nolog;

#define CHECK_CCOLOR_FAIL(v) \
	{ \
		CStr str = v; \
		CColor a; \
		TS_ASSERT(!a.ParseString(str, 255)); \
	}

		CHECK_CCOLOR_FAIL("abc");
		CHECK_CCOLOR_FAIL("0.123 1 2 3");
		CHECK_CCOLOR_FAIL("0 0 0 0 adfasd");
		CHECK_CCOLOR_FAIL("0 a0 b0 ax");
		CHECK_CCOLOR_FAIL("-124dsaf");
		CHECK_CCOLOR_FAIL("\0");
		CHECK_CCOLOR_FAIL("1 2 xxxx");

		// Not enough parameters
		CHECK_CCOLOR_FAIL("");
		CHECK_CCOLOR_FAIL("124");
		CHECK_CCOLOR_FAIL("0 55");

		// More parameters than allowed
		CHECK_CCOLOR_FAIL("0 5 1 5 6");

		// Out of bounds
		CHECK_CCOLOR_FAIL("-1 0 0");
		CHECK_CCOLOR_FAIL("256 0 0 0");
		CHECK_CCOLOR_FAIL("255 256 -1 0");
#undef CHECK_CCLOLO_FAIL
	}

private:
	void CheckColor(int r, int g, int b, u32 expected)
	{
		SColor4ub colorStruct = ConvertRGBColorTo4ub(RGBColor(r,g,b));
		u32 actual;
		memcpy(&actual, &colorStruct, sizeof(u32));
		expected |= 0xff000000;	// ConvertRGBColorTo4ub sets alpha to opaque
		TS_ASSERT_EQUALS(expected, actual);
	}
};
